Business Development Manager

Location: Redmond, WA (Onsite/Hybrid)

Schedule: During training for the first month the role will be onsite 5 days/week, then will be hybrid 3 days/week matching the sponsor s schedule (currently Mon-Wed onsite).

Duration: 12+ Months, potential for extension

Maintains and develops internal and external relationships with business and technical peers for assigned partners. Utilizes process to support development and maintenance of pipeline; prepares information for reporting to key stakeholders. Escalates to manager as needed. Closes opportunities using predefined program frameworks or templates, as applicable. Assists with execution and deal management by communicating and reporting with stakeholders. Tracks blocking issues and works with deal stakeholders to drive resolutions. Supports post-deal governance and execution plans by working with internal and partner stakeholders across business and technical and operational teams. and supports measurement results by assessing progress against. KPIs defined success metrics (e.g., revenue, volume of opportunities in the pipeline/channel).

Typical Day in the Role Purpose of the Team: The purpose of this team is working on partnerships & licensing for a large gaming studio Key projects: This role will contribute to license importing for a large gaming studio. Their job is to manage the partners and get new /replace partners that are not meeting expectations. Core game, development, outsourcing partners, support partners. Will be working with attorneys and handle standardized negotiations and forms that they use. Typical task breakdown and operating rhythm: The role will consist of 50-60% meetings, 25% working with attorneys on drafting agreements and negotiations, 15-20% managing processes for the triage.
